This is my grandma's recipe. I think it is the best! Hope you enjoy!
1 lb hamburger
1 small onion
1 can tomato sauce
1 can tomato paste
1 envelope spaghetti mix
salt and pepper to taste
1 tbsp worchestershire sauce
1 clove garlic
Brown hamburger and onion. Add salt and pepper. Stir in tomato sauce and paste, then one can of water in each. Add spaghetti mix. Add minced garlic, Worchestershire sauce and simmer until blended well.
ok..so here is an additon to the recipe I submitted yesterday. My grandma is a "pinch of this,dab of that" kind of cook. She said she sometimes adds italian seasoning, some sugar, and/or cinnamon. Sometimes to stretch it she will add a jar of Ragu too. So, basically it is a trial and error recipe.
